Transaction 644f8ba676cefe38d92133eaeec2cf2b9bce7dffecedaac63d24304200dc3da1
1 Input
1 Output
-
644f8ba676cefe38d92133eaeec2cf2b9bce7dffecedaac63d24304200dc3da1:0
- value
- 153850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72c737199260e4bc64e5353c923dad3a3044b54 OP_EQUAL
- address
- 3MJkTHyu6SVn3dpMtUEvjmgE4awHmkDXs8